Top Learning Tools


In the realm of online education, academic applications have established themselves as a significant tool for engagement and skill enhancement. An exceptional example is "Scratch platform," a system that teaches coding through hands-on storytelling and gameplay creation. A further outstanding game is "Prodigy," which dips players in an captivating fantasy environment while reinforcing math concepts. The game adapts to each player’s ability level, providing customized challenges that keep learners engaged. With its fusion of adventure and educational content, Prodigy allows children to practice math in an dynamic way, making it easier to comprehend concepts they could have difficulty with in standard settings.


"Wordscapes App" offers a novel twist on vocabulary and spelling through letter puzzles. Gamers must connect letters to build words, gradually unlocking new stages and challenges. This game not only improves language abilities but also enhances critical thinking as gamers strategize to place words into different puzzles. With its relaxing yet engaging gameplay, Wordscapes turns learning into an enjoyable experience that everyone can benefit from.


Advantages of Acquiring Knowledge Through Play


Acquiring knowledge through games provides an entertaining way for players to grasp new information and competencies. When participants are engaged in a game environment, they often experience a feeling of exploration and challenge, which can increase motivation and concentration. This interactive method allows learners to explore concepts and practice problem-solving in a safe environment, making it simpler to grasp complex concepts.


Another significant advantage is the instant feedback that games provide. Players can quickly see the outcomes of their actions, allowing them to understand what tactics work and where they need to progress. This real-time assessment encourages a development mindset, where learners feel empowered to take risks and learn from their mistakes rather than fearing failure. The repetitive nature of games fosters resilience and adaptability, traits essential for lifelong education.


Furthermore, many digital games promote teamwork and community engagement. Participants often work in groups or compete against each other, which improves communication skills and teamwork. This social feature not only makes learning more enjoyable but also helps develop essential social abilities. As learners engage with one another, they can share knowledge and strategies, creating a community of support that enriches the educational journey.


How to Choose the Right Game


When selecting an online game for efficient learning, consider the subject matter that matches your educational goals. Various games focus on various areas such as mathematics, science, language skills, or history. Recognizing the specific skills or knowledge you want to enhance will assist narrow down your options. Look for games that are designed to target these areas while also being engaging and interactive.


Another crucial factor is the age suitability of the game. Not every games are suitable for all age group, so it is vital to choose a game that suits the age and developmental level of the learner. Games designed for younger children may emphasize basic concepts and visual learning, while games for older students can focus on complex problem-solving and critical thinking. Ensuring the game is suitable can enhance both enjoyment and effectiveness.


Finally, consider the game’s format and accessibility. Some learners flourish in cooperative environments, while others may prefer competitive play. Check if the game provides multiplayer options or single-player experiences, and make sure it is compatible with the devices the learners will use. Accessibility features, such as multilingual options or adapted controls, can also make a significant difference in the overall learning experience.
